We know almost everything about the Huawei Honor 7X, except the single important information, that is the price tag. Many tech enthusiasts are quoting a different set of price-tag and the users may not be happy with some of the price tags.

The smartphone does offer almost identical specifications compared to the already available Huawei Honor 9i (which retails in India for ₹17,999 for the 4 GB RAM and 64 GB storage variant). So, we at The India Wire predict that the smartphone is likely to retail for ₹12,999 for the 3 GB RAM and 32 GB storage variant and ₹14,999 for the 4 GB RAM and 64 GB storage variant.

The smartphone offers a premium metal design which is in line with the other premium flagship smartphones, in fact, the device is almost identical to that of the Huawei Honor 9i, except for the dual camera setup on the front.

Let’s look at the pros and the cons of the Honor 7x to make your choice easier.

Pros:

  • Best-in-class premium build quality.
  • Dual rear-camera setup with best-in-class camera performance.
  • Massive 5.99-inch FHD+ 2160x1080p resolution IPS LCD display, protected by 2.5D curved tempered glass on the top with 18:9 aspect ratio.
  • Semi-new Android Nougat 7.1.2 with custom EMUI on the top that offers a lot of customisation options.
  • Almost bezel-less design, which is in line with the 2017 smartphone.
  • 32/64/128 GB onboard flash storage with a dedicated Hybrid micro SD card slot (up to 256 GB).
  • 3 GB or 4 GB LPDDR3 RAM.
  • Dual nano-SIM card slots with 4G LTE and VoLte on both the slots.
  • The well-positioned fingerprint scanner on the back, which is heavily responsive.

Cons:

  • No IP rating for the water and dust resistance.
  • Still uses a micro USB port for charging and data syncing.
  • 3340 mAh battery might bug out by the end of the day.
  • Everyone may not appreciate the EMUI over the stock Android.
  • HiSilicon Kirin 659 Octa-core Processor might not be suitable for heavily demanding tasks.

Considering the fact that, the Xiaomi Redmi 5 and the Redmi 5 Plus is around the corner, which is expected to be priced less than ₹10,000 for the entry-level model, the pricing of the Huawei Honor 7X does play an important role.

The company is planning a grand launch in London on December 5th and the smartphone will be available from 7th December via Amazon India. One can also expect initial offers from the brand for the first day buyers. Our only worry is that the pricing should not damage the almost well-built smartphone.
